What is Habitat for Humanity?
A unique opportunity to impact the lives of others. Working side-by-side with families who are building their own home, and rebuilding their lives, volunteers and donors see tangible results and form powerful relationships.

We serve and build in Orange Park, Middleburg, Green Cove Springs, Keystone Heights and Penney Farms.

Mission Statement
Striving to eliminate substandard housing in Clay County, Florida by building and renovating safe, decent and affordable housing in partnership with the community and God’s people in need.

Collegiate Challenge is coming!
Look for amazing young folks from Wake Forest and Penn State during the week of March 8-12. Did You Know? Collegiate Challenge is their alternative to Spring Break partying - instead they volunteer with Habitat throughout the U.S.!


Florida Habitat affiliates have built 10,000 houses to date!
Florida Habitat affiliates outpace the rest of the country in construction by 30% . . . making us the biggest contributor to the tithe, so we build more homes internationally as well!
